For either, father, we ought not formerly to have been bestowed in marriage, unless our husbands pleased you, or, it is not right for us now to be taken away when they are absent.
ANTIPHO
And shall I suffer you while I am alive to remain married to men who are beggars?
PAMPHILA
This beggar of mine is agreable to me; her own king is agreable[*] to the queen. In poverty have I the same feelings that once I had in riches.
ANTIPHO
And do you set such high value on thieves and beggars?
PHILUMENA
You did not, as I think, give me in marriage to the money, but to the man.
ANTIPHO
Why are you still in expectation of those who have been absent for now three years? Why dont you accept an eligible match[*] in place of a very bad one?
PAMPHILA
Tis folly, father, to lead unwilling dogs to hunt.
That wife is an enemy, who is given to a man in marriage against her will.
ANTIPHO
Are you then determined that neither of you will obey the command of your father?
PHILUMENA
We do obey; for where you gave us in marriage, thence are we unwilling to depart.
ANTIPHO
Kindly good bye; Ill go and tell my friends your resolutions.
PAMPHILA
They will, I doubt not, think us the more honorable, if you tell them to honorable men.
ANTIPHO
Take you care, then, of their domestic concerns, the best way that you can.
(Exit.)
PHILUMENA
Now you gratify us, when you direct us aright: now we will hearken to you. Now, sister, lets go indoors.
PAMPHILA
Well, first Ill take a look at home. If, perchance, any news should come to you from your husband, take you care that I know it.
PHILUMENA
Neither will I conceal it from you, nor do you conceal from me what you may know.
(Calls at the door of her house.) Ho there, Crocotium[*], go, fetch hither Gelasimus, the Parasite; bring him here with you. For, i faith, I wish to send him to the harbour, to see if, perchance, any ship from Asia[*] has arrived there yesterday or to-day. But, one servant has been sitting at the harbour whole days in waiting; still, however, I wish it to be visited every now and then. Make haste, and return immediately.
(Each goes into her own house.)

(Enter GELASIMUS.)
GELASIMUS
I do suspect that Famine was my mother; for since I was born I have never been filled with victuals. And no man could better return the favour to his mother, than do I right unwillingly return it to my mother, Famine. For in her womb, for ten months she bore me,
whereas I have been carrying her for more than ten years in my stomach. She, too, carried me but a little child, wherefore I judge that she endured the less labour; in my stomach no little Famine do I bear, but of full growth, i faith, and extremely heavy.
The labour-pains arise with me each day, but Im unable to bring forth my mother, nor know I what to do. Ive often heard it so said that the elephant is wont[*] to be pregnant ten whole years; for sure this hunger of mine is of its breed.
For now for many a year has it been clinging to, my inside. Now, if any person wants a droll fellow, I am on sale, with all my equipage: of a filling-up for these chasms am I in search. When little, my father gave me the name of Gelasimus[*],
because, even from a tiny child, I was a droll chap. By reason of poverty, in fact, did I acquire this name, because, it was poverty that made me to be a droll; for whenever she reaches a person, she instructs him thoroughly in every art. My father used to say that I was born when provisions were dear;
for that reason, I do believe, I am now the more sharply set. But on our family such complacence has been bestowedI am in the habit of refusing no person, if any one asks me out to eat. One form of expression has most unfortunately died away with people, and one, i faith, most beseeming and most elegant to my thinking,
which formerly they employed: Come here to dinnerdo soreally, do promisedont make any difficultiesis it convenient?—I wish it to be so, I say; Ill not part with you unless you come.
